NRITYAM: Language Models Meet Art and Heritage of Dance

Researchers have introduced NRITYAM, a comprehensive multilingual benchmark dataset containing 9,260 question-answer pairs across 12 languages designed to evaluate how well language models understand global dance traditions and cultural heritage. Developed in collaboration with native dance artists and speakers, the dataset addresses a critical gap in AI evaluation by testing cultural comprehension beyond Western-centric knowledge, establishing new standards for assessing AI systems' ability to reason about traditional performing arts.

Developing a Culturally Grounded, AI-Augmented UX Research Point of View (POV): An Exemplar Case Study from Telemedicine Dementia Care

Researchers developed a culturally grounded, AI-augmented User Experience Research (UXR) framework for TeleDeCa, a telemedicine dementia care system serving family caregivers in Nigeria. The study demonstrates how generative AI can support UXR methodology in low-resource, culturally sensitive contexts while maintaining human oversight and ethical accountability, producing reusable design patterns for future AI-powered research applications.

JuICE: A Benchmark for Evaluating LLM-Judge in Identifying Cultural Errors

Researchers introduce JuICE, a multilingual benchmark dataset revealing that current LLM-judges struggle to identify cultural errors in AI-generated responses, achieving only 52% F1 scores. The study demonstrates that LLMs fail to capture nuanced cultural contexts across diverse regions, suggesting existing evaluation methods inadequately assess cultural appropriateness in global AI deployment.

A Unified Framework to Quantify Cultural Intelligence of AI

Researchers have developed a unified framework to systematically measure the cultural intelligence of AI systems as generative AI technologies expand globally. The framework addresses the need for comprehensive assessment of AI's ability to operate across diverse cultural contexts, moving beyond fragmented evaluation approaches to provide a systematic methodology for measuring cultural competence.
